busybox: fix watchdog util compile
[openwrt.git] / package / ppp / files / pppoe.sh
index f263caa..c0bb515 100644 (file)
@@ -6,16 +6,19 @@ setup_interface_pppoe() {
        local iface="$1"
        local config="$2"
        
-       config_get device "$config" device
-
        for module in slhc ppp_generic pppox pppoe; do
                /sbin/insmod $module 2>&- >&-
        done
 
-       config_get mtu "$cfg" mtu
-       mtu=${mtu:-1480}
+       # make sure the network state references the correct ifname
+       scan_ppp "$config"
+       config_get ifname "$config" ifname
+       set_interface_ifname "$config" "$ifname"
+
+       config_get mtu "$config" mtu
+       mtu=${mtu:-1492}
        start_pppd "$config" \
                plugin rp-pppoe.so \
                mtu $mtu mru $mtu \
-               "nic-$device"
+               "nic-$iface"
 }
This page took 0.031141 seconds and 4 git commands to generate.